#Section 4: Fundamentals of Biological Engineering
A continuous process is set up for treatment of wastewater. Each day, 105 kg cellulose and 103 kg bacteria enter in the feed stream, while 104 kg cellulose and 1.5 x 104 kg bacteria leave in the effluent. The rate of cellulose digestion by the bacteria is 7 x 104 kg d-1. The rate of bacterial growth is 2 x 104 kg d-1 ; the rate of cell death by lysis is 5 x 102 kg d-1. Write balances for cellulose and bacteria in the system.
